This class is great for anybody considering getting their own hive or for those who simply want to learn about bees first-hand and up-close.

We will start with an overview about how bees live, breed, and how they often move into the walls of homes. Then we will open several hives to see first-hand how they build their combs and store their nectar/honey/pollen. We will find the queen and spot her eggs. We will see larvae of different ages and usually see bees hatching out of their cocoons. We will also taste different batches of honey from local hives.
